Bartender4 is a full ActionBar replacement mod. It provides you with all the features needed to fully customization most aspects of your action and related bars.

WoW 5.0 and Mists of Pandaria
Since version 4.5.0, Bartender4 is fully compatible with WoW 5.0 and Mists of Pandaria. Note however that this version is no longer compatible with WoW 4.3/Cataclysm.

Features
  • Support for all Action Bars and all related bars

    - 10 Action Bars
    - Stance Bar
    - Pet Bar
    - Bag Bar
    - Micro Menu
    - XP/Reputation Bar
  • All Bars are fully customizable (Scale, Alpha, Fade-Out settings, ...)
  • Very flexible and customizable Show/Hide driver based on Macro Conditions
  • Additional Layout and Paging settings for Action Bars

    - Page all bars based on Stance or Modifier
    - Possess Bar support
    - Custom State driver support with Macro Conditions
  • Options to hide specific elements of the buttons (Macro Text, HotKey, more could be added on demand)
  • StickyFrames support
  • Masque/ButtonFacade support!
  • Easy Hotkey Binding using KeyBound
  • Options to control the hiding of the default blizzard artwork (you might still want that to be displayed..)

FAQ
Q: How do i access the Configuration?
A: You can open the configuration with the Slash Commands (/bt or /bar) or through the Bartender4 LDB plugin.

Q: Can Bartender4 import settings from Bartender3?
A: No. Those two mods are too different to be able to import settings.

Q: Where are my keybindings? And how do i bind new keys?
A: BT3 Keybindings will not be ported over either, you have to use the new KeyBound to re-bind your keys. You can access KeyBound by its slash command (/kb) or through the button in the BT4 config. Hover a button, press key → voila!

Q: CyCircled Support? I like my button skins?
A: No reason to cry! There is a sparkling new skinning addon/library out there! ButtonFacade is way easier to work with as a action-bar author, and its easier to write skins for it too! Alot of cyCircled Skins have already been ported to ButtonFacade, and more are on their way! After installing ButtonFacade just use its configuration to change the skin of the BT4 buttons (/bf)

Q: How do i disable the snapping of the bars?
A: Currently, you can temporarily override the snapping by holding down the Shift Key while moving your bars, or uncheck the option in the popup when your bars are unlocked.

=== Changelog ===

4.5.9
* Updated for 5.2

4.5.8
* Fixed a Lua error related to spell flyouts

4.5.7
* Fixed a Lua error when entering vehicles

4.5.6
* Support for WoW 5.1, Loss Of Control Cooldowns and the works!

4.5.5
* Fixed Enabling/Disabling of the Pet Bar

4.5.4
* Added an option to hide the pet bars button grid (empty buttons)
* Fixed Fadeout with Flyout actions
* Fixed action range display when using the self-cast modifier for bar paging
* Using spanish translation for mexican WoW clients

4.5.3
* Improved handling of Override ActionBars which are not classified as vehicles (Darkmoon Faire games, and others)
* Added a visibility option to hide the bars when an override bar is active
* Fixed Shadowdance stance paging
* Even more fixes for the Reputation and XP bar

4.5.2
* Added a separate stance option for Shadowdance
* Fixed Incarnation: Tree of Life paging
* More fixes for the Reputation and XP bar

4.5.1
* Fixed the reputation and XP bars
* Removed the empty Totem Bar
* Improved Vehicle/Possess Bar handling

4.5.0
* Full support for WoW 5.0 and Mist of Pandaria
* Support for Pet Battles (all Bartender bars are hidden when the Pet Battle UI is shown)
* Full support for Monk stances
* Updated all stance code for changes in 5.0
* Support for spec-based profiles using LibDualSpec-1.0
* Added an option to change the direction of button flyouts (eg. summon demon/pet)
* Improved Vehicle Bar (no more missing "Leave Vehicle" button on some vehicles)
* Improved Masque integration

4.4.20.1
* Updated for 4.3

4.4.19
* Updated for 4.2

4.4.18
* Updated for 4.1

4.4.17
* Fixed disappearing Micro Menu

4.4.16
* Updates for the 4.0.6 patch

4.4.15
* Re-Added the "Leave Vehicle" button on Button 12 of the Possess Bar
* Added an option to toggle spells on key-down instead of key-up
* Cosmetic and internal fixes

4.4.14
* Fixed Blizzard Vehicle UI taint issues
* Fixed alot of keybinding related problems.
* Added an option to hide the "Equipped" border on buttons

4.4.13
* Fixed right-click self casting on modifier switched bars
* Fixed Vehicle UI button rebinding
* Bartender will now apply the "Blizzard" preset to new profiles
* Fixed hotkey out-of-range mode
* The "NormalTexture" is hidden once again now (the extra border around buttons)

4.4.12
* Fixed another issue with button locks
* Fixed an issue that tainted the UI and caused shaman totem bars to break

4.4.11
* Fixed the "Show Grid" option
* Fixed spell flyout buttons
* Convert old keybindings on Bar 1 to the new format

4.4.10
* Fixed self casting
* Fixed Show/Hide of HotKeys and Macro Names
* Fixed Button Locking
* Fixed keybinding shortening

4.4.9
* Support for the 4.0 Cataclysm Patch!
* Alot of internal changes for future plans
* New "Presets" module and "Blizzard Art" bar

4.4.2
* Support for the 3.3.0 Content Patch!
* Fixed the offset of the Totem Bar Drag Handle

4.4.1
* Fixed a condition that could potentially taint the Totem Bar and resulting in loss of functionality in Combat

4.4.0
* Support for the 3.2.0 Content Patch, including the new Totem Bar!
* Alot of Performance Tweaks
* Fixes and new localizations

4.3.3
* Fixed a glitch with the default vehicle UI to prevent taint from other addons.

4.3.2
* Added support for Page Swapping for Shadow Dance.
* Fixed Range Coloring and HotKey display for vehicle buttons.
* Fixed an error in the action button code.
* Fixed an error with the micro menu in vertical layout.

4.3.1
* Update all buttons when the talent spec is changed

4.3.0
* Fully updated for the 3.1.0 Content Patch!
* Refactored Positioning system. This //might// cause your saved bar positions to shift slightly. This is a one time change, but it was necessary for new features to come.
* Implemented a new "Positioning" Tab located on the options page of every individual bar.
[/b] Adjust the position of the bars with an absolute precision.
[/b] Options to center Bars both vertically and horizontally.
* Added an option to use the default Blizzard Vehicle Art on vehicles.
* Alot of internal refactoring of the state system and related functions.
* Numerous fixes and enhacements.

4.2.6
* Enabled the Chat Command interface, you can now use the /bt4 slash command to change various options in macros
* Localization Updates
* Internal tweaks and fixes

4.2.5
* Fixed a bug with Click-Through not properly applying after login

4.2.4
* Fixed Hotkey Range-Indicator
* Added Click-Through Support for a number of bars

4.2.3
* Fixed error in Button-Alignment with certain numbers of Rows
* Added "Hide on Vehicles" preset to visibility options

4.2.2
* Resolved "Black Button" issue with spells that require Rage/Mana/etc
* Improved behavior of the "Leave Vehicle" button to also cancel Mind Control etc.

4.2.1
* Added a Vehicle Bar with an additional "Leave Vehicle" button and the Pitch-Control buttons
* Potential fix for the issues with Possess/Vehicle Buttons not working properly

4.2.0
* Refactored ActionButton code (now using the Blizzard Template)
[/b] Empty Buttons are now completly click-through
[/b] Errors with empty buttons/wrong textures with ButtonFacade should be fixed
* MicroMenu now uses the ButtonBar prototype, allowing full Row/Padding control
* Added the keybindings to the Blizzard Keybinding Menu in addition to KeyBound
* Added support for Focus-Casting
* Added a minimap Icon to access the configuration
* Added support for specifying the fade-out alpha within a custom conditional string
* Fixed Hotkey on Pet and Stance Bar
* Re-arranged alot of options
* Fixed alot of errors with option handling

4.1.2
* Added new Popup Dialog in "Unlock Mode" that allows you to quickly lock the bars again and disable snapping
* Fixed initial starting positions of the bars, should no longer overlap. If they still do in rare cases, just move them ;)

4.1.1
* Fixed bugs with switching profiles
* Fixed a bug that caused the visibility to not properly refresh when unlocking/locking bars

4.1.0
* First public release for Patch 3.0
